FAQ

How do I find my driver at the airport?
Your driver will be waiting with a sign displaying your name or preferred name outside the airport or your hotel, making them easy to spot after a long journey.
What does the price include?
The $40 fee covers private transportation and all parking fees. However, tolls between $15 and $30 are not included and are paid separately.
Is this service available in both directions?
Yes, you can book this as either a one-way transfer from Kingston Airport to your hotel or from your hotel back to the airport.
How far in advance should I book?
The service is typically booked about 5 days before travel, but booking earlier guarantees availability, especially during busy seasons.
What if my flight is delayed?
Since the service confirms at the time of booking, it’s best to communicate any delays. The driver is likely to wait for a reasonable period, but it’s wise to coordinate with the provider.
Are the vehicles suitable for luggage?
Yes, drivers assist with luggage, and the vehicles are roomy enough for bags, ensuring a comfortable ride.
Can service animals travel with me?
Yes, service animals are allowed, so you can travel with your assistance animal comfortably.
